A photography enthusiast recently captured a stunning moment in Erdaoqiao Village, Kangding City, southwest China's Sichuan Province, during the courtship ritual of the white eared-pheasant, a nationally protected species.The male, adorned in vibrant plumage, displayed its colors and performed an intricate dance to attract a mate.
The species is omnivorous, with its primary diet consisting of plant matter such as stems, leaves, flowers, fruits, seeds and crops. It also supplements its diet by occasionally eating insects and small animals. In addition to Sichuan, the species is also found in Xizang, Guizhou, Guangxi and Yunnan in China.
